推荐
专栏
教程
课程
飞鹅
本次共找到1347条
分布式事务
相关的信息
Easter79
•
3年前
tidb入门
由于目前的项目把mysql换成了TiDb,所以特意来了解下tidb。其实也不能说换,由于tidb和mysql几乎完全兼容,所以我们的程序没有任何改动就完成了数据库从mysql到TiDb的转换,TiDB是一个分布式NewSQL(SQL、NoSQL和NewSQL的优缺点比较)数据库。它支持水平弹性扩展、ACID事务、标准SQL、MySQL
LosAngel
•
4年前
golang实现MySQL数据库事物的提交与回滚
MySQL事务主要用于处理操作量大,复杂度高的数据。在MySQL中只有使用了Innodb数据库引擎的数据库或表才支持事务。事务用来管理insert,update,delete语句,事务处理可以用来维护数据库的完整性,保证成批的SQL语句要么全部执行,要么全部不执行。一般来说,事务是必须满足4个条件(ACID)::原子性(Atomicit
lix_uan
•
3年前
MySQL学习总结
数据库的三大范式第一范式:每个列都不可以再拆分第二范式:在第一范式的基础上,非主键列完全依赖于主键第三范式:在第二范式上,非主键列只依赖主键,不依赖其他非主键事务的并发问题脏读:事务A读取了事务B更新的数据,然后数据B回滚,那么A读到的是脏数据不可重复读:事务A多次读取同一数据,事务B在事务A读取的过程中对数据进行了修改并提交,导致A多次读的数据
Easter79
•
3年前
Spring事务(一):Spring事务的使用
什么是事务事务的经典举例:某人要在商店使用电子货币购买100元的东西,当中至少包括两个操作:1.该人账户减少100元2.商店账户增加100元事务就是要确保以上两个操作都能完成或者一起取消,否则就会出现100元平白消失或出现的情况。(摘自wiki(https://www.oschina.net/action/
Stella981
•
3年前
InnoDB MVCC何时创建read view
导读InnoDBMVCC是事务一启动就创建readview,还是什么时候?几个关于事务的基本概念说到事务,我们不得不先说下什么是ACID、MVCC、consistentread、readview等几个基本概念。ACIDACID是事务的原子性、一致性、隔离性、持久性4个单词的首字母
Stella981
•
3年前
Spring AOP 实现
AOP(AspectOrientProgramming),我们一般称为面向切面编程,作为面向对象的一种补充,用于处理系统中分布于各个模块的横切关注点,比如事务、日志、缓存、分布式锁等等。AOP实现的关键在于AOP框架自动创建的AOP代理,AOP代理主要分为静态代理和动态代理,静态代理的代表为AspectJ;而动态代理则以SpringAOP为代表。Spr
Wesley13
•
3年前
MySql学习17
一.数据库事务的四大特性(ACID)如果一个数据库声称支持事务的操作,那么该数据库必须要具备以下四个特性:原子性(Atomicity):原子性是指事务包含的所有操作要么全部成功,要么全部失败回滚,这和前面两篇博客介绍事务的功能是一样的概念,因此事务的操作如果成功就必须要完全应用到数据库,如果操
Wesley13
•
3年前
Mysql 数据可靠性机制
Mysql主要通过binlog跟redolog来保证数据的可靠性binlog的写入机制binlog的写入逻辑比较简单:事务执行过程中,先把日志写到binlogcache,事务提交的时候,再把binlogcache写到binlog文件中一个事务的binlog是不能被拆开的,因此不论这个事务多大,也要确保一
Wesley13
•
3年前
mysql事务
事务用于将某些操作的多个SQL作为原子性操作,一旦有某一个出现错误,即可回滚到原来的状态,从而保证数据库数据完整性。原始数据createtableuser(idintprimarykeyauto_increment,namechar(32),balanceint);
Stella981
•
3年前
Redis 事务
Redis事务一、理论1.是什么: 可以一次执行多个命令,本质是一组命令的集合。一个事务中的所有命令都会序列化,按顺序地串行化执行而不会被其他命令插入,不许加塞。2.作用: 一个队列中,一次性、顺序性、排他性地执行一系列命令3.常用命令: 通过MUL
1
•••
11
12
13
•••
135